Welcome to the Zensim wiki!
Zensim is short for Zenus Simulation, which is an open-source C++ library designed for high-performance physics-based simulations. It is built upon a highly efficient parallel computing framework called ZPC, i.e. Zenus Parallel Compute, that offers a c++stl-like and consistent programming interface for multiple compute back-ends including OpenMP, Cuda, etc., and a series of efficient, highly-customizable and commonly-used data structures.
Currently, ZPC mainly handles computations within a shared-memory and heterogeneous architecture. Hopefully it may extend to a distributed system in the near future.
Zensim is and will be continuously developed and maintained by Zenus Tech to provide better support for simulation-related research and development, especially for practical real-world problems.
